Download and Use the Results

Once a study has been created there are several options that allow the data to be shared or downloaded for use in Excel or GIS:

Sharing a study

Under My Studies, you can toggle a button that says 'Make study public.' Once you turn it on, the text turns into a link that you can open and share with anyone. The link has a map, that nobody else can edit, and a table, with the data from the study.

You can also print the page to PDF from your browser, if you'd like to put it in a report. The process to do so varies by browser.

Downloading study data

CSV

Under My Studies, there is a button at the bottom of the menu that allows you to download a CSV of all of your studies. You can open this file in Excel or any program that can read CSVs, where you can then sort your studies by the number of people connected, jobs connected, miles of low stress islands, or any other piece of data.

GeoJSON

You can download a GeoJSON of any individual study, which will include both the segments you analyzed, as well as the blobs and buffers that are associated with that project. You can do that under the Actions button on the left side of the My Studies table.

You can upload the "segments" GeoJSON back into LINK, if desired.
